OpenCores
URL https://opencores.org/ocsvn/neorv32/neorv32/trunk

Subversion Repositories neorv32

[/] [neorv32/] [trunk/] [sw/] [lib/] [source/] [neorv32_gpio.c] - Diff between revs 23 and 26

Go to most recent revision | Show entire file | Details | Blame | View Log

Rev 23 Rev 26
Line 135... Line 135...
/**********************************************************************//**
/**********************************************************************//**
 * Configure pin-change IRQ mask for input pins.
 * Configure pin-change IRQ mask for input pins.
 *
 *
 * @note The pin-change IRQ will trigger on any transition (rising and falling edge) for any enabled input pin.
 * @note The pin-change IRQ will trigger on any transition (rising and falling edge) for any enabled input pin.
 *
 *
 * @param[in] pin_en Mask to select which input pins can cause a pin-change IRQ (32-bit), 1 = pin enabled.
 * @param[in] pin_sel Mask to select which input pins can cause a pin-change IRQ (32-bit), 1 = pin enabled.
 **************************************************************************/
 **************************************************************************/
void neorv32_gpio_pin_change_config(uint32_t pin_sel) {
void neorv32_gpio_pin_change_config(uint32_t pin_sel) {
 
 
  GPIO_INPUT = pin_sel;
  GPIO_INPUT = pin_sel;
}
}

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.